•Designed and built out a Rails microservice backend for referrals experiments. Generated client A/B test allocations via a data science-owned service and shared data with consumers of API. Extra focus on resiliency, including a Redis caching layer and fallback logic paths to ensure maximum response speed and up time.
•Worked on a task force team whose goal was to get engineering off of the shared database. Improved observability into connection usage on a per-application basis. Paired with platform engineers to port
individualized, per-app PgBouncer instances to global PgBouncer instance that managed database connection pooling for all apps in ecosystem.
•Collaborated with software architect to design Golang microservice for managing distributed transactions across the broader application ecosystem.
•Served as project lead and technical lead on a project critical to UK launch. Added new shipping options for UK clients and changed how client shipping data and carrier preferences were managed. Coordinated with three other engineering teams as well as UX, Product, and Strategy.
•Extracted front end component written with plain HTML / CSS / JavaScript from legacy Rails app into NPM module written in React. Added full test coverage using Enzyme and Jest. Learned React for this
project and brought rest of team up to speed.
•Managed summer intern and served as technical mentor. Taught test driven development via pair programming. Helped deepen her skills in git, JavaScript, and Ruby on Rails. Supported her in successfully delivering a stylist hiring microapp that cut need for manual engineering work.
•Founded and led engineering reading group to strengthen organizational culture of learning and create a shared knowledge base.